Applications
4-Fluoro-L-phenylalanine is a substrate for tyrosine hydroxylase (TH) that has been used to study the regulation of that enzyme.

Solubility
Soluble in water and 0.5M HCl (50 mg/ml).

Notes
Stable under recommended storage conditions. Incompatible with oxidizing agents.
